探索多台服务器部署同一个项目的优势与技巧

何为多台服务器部署同一个项目?

在数字化迅猛进步的今天,企业越来越多地使用多台服务器来承载同一个项目。你有没有想过,为什么要这样做呢?多台服务器部署同一个项目,主要是为了提升体系的稳定性、可靠性和处理能力。想象一下,如果只有一台服务器承担所有的业务,若它发生故障,整个项目可能就会陷入瘫痪。而通过多台服务器的协同职业,即使某台服务器出现难题,其他服务器也可以继续维持服务,这样有效进步了体系的可用性。

多台服务器部署的益处

开门见山说,多台服务器可以实现负载均衡。当用户访问网站时,请求会被均匀地分配到不同的服务器上,这样可以避免某一台服务器的过载。同时,它还可以进步数据处理速度,用户在同一时刻段内的请求能够快速响应,从而提升用户体验。你是否在网上购物时遇到过页面加载缓慢的情况?这往往是由于服务器负载过重。通过多台服务器处理,可以大大减少这种情况的发生。

接下来要讲,通过数据备份和冗余设计,多台服务器能够有效保障数据安全。例如,企业可以在不同地点部署服务器,通过实时同步数据,确保数据在其中任何一台服务器出现故障时,都能迅速恢复并继续正常运作。这样一来,企业的数据安全性得到了大幅提升,尤其在面对网络攻击或天然灾害时,保障了业务的连续性,你说这是不是很重要呢?

实现多台服务器部署的关键点

那么,怎样实施多台服务器部署同一个项目呢?开门见山说,选择合适的服务器架构至关重要。你可以采用主从服务器架构,主服务器负责数据写入,而从服务器则用于数据读取和备份。这样的设计不仅进步了体系的性能,也简化了数据管理。

接下来要讲,建立合理的数据同步机制也是不可或缺的一步。通过定期和实时同步,确保所有服务器之间的数据一致性。例如,基于日志的同步技术能够实时捕捉数据变化,确保每一台服务器上的数据都能保持最新。这样,当一名用户在某一台服务器上完成交易,其他服务器也能立即反映出这一变化,保证了数据的准确性。

面临的挑战及应对策略

虽然多台服务器部署有诸多好处,但在实际操作中也会面临一些挑战。例如,数据冲突在多台服务器环境中是常常会遇到的难题。想象一下,如果两台服务器同时修改同一数据,可能会导致数据不一致。为了应对这一挑战,你可以考虑使用版本控制或者数据合并算法,确保每一条数据都有准确的版本记录,以便在发生冲突时进行有效的处理。

顺带提一嘴,网络延迟也一个影响多台服务器效率的重要影响。在分布式环境下,服务器之间的通信可能出现延迟,这可能会影响数据同步的及时性。你可以通过优化网络配置、使用缓存技术来减小对网络的依赖,从而进步数据同步的效率。

拓展资料

聊了这么多,多台服务器部署同一个项目,可以有效提升体系的可靠性、安全性,以及用户体验,然而实施经过中也需要注意挑战并制定相应的解决方案。只有通过合理的架构设计、数据管理和优化措施,才能使多台服务器协同职业,充分发挥它们的优势,为企业的数字化转型提供强有力的支持。你是否已经对多台服务器的部署有了新的认识?如果你还在犹豫,不妨赶紧行动起来!

版权声明